SCRAM Welcomes newest addition to the team, Andrew!
Here’s a bit about Dru!
“My passion for Sport, Health and Fitness was sparked at a noticeably young age when I was told the story about Austin Cassar Torregiani, a relative than ran the 100m against the great Jessie Owens in the 1936 Olympic Games in Berlin. My 15 year journey as a track and field athlete has taken me around the world and given me the opportunity to represent Malta on the National team on several occasions. The peak of my career was in 2018 when I represented Malta at the Commonwealth Games in Australia, the memories of performing in front of such a crowd as well as my family will give me goosebumps for years to come.
My love for sport transcends my own personal goals on the track, I am also committed to expanding and sharing my knowledge about health, fitness and performance in order to share with others and help make small yet effective and positive changes in people’s lives.
With experiences at Loughborough University as a Sports Therapist, working as an F45 Coach in Australia and recently qualifying as a Pilates instructor, I am confident that together with the team at SCRAM, we can help you maximise the benefits of your time spent in the gym and help you recover in an intelligent way.
